Deputy Stole Dog, $65,000 From Elderly Woman: Sheriff

The Sarasota County Sheriff’s Office has announced the arrest of one of its own following an investigation into allegations of harassment and theft. According to the agency, one if its deputies stole more than $65,000 from an elderly woman and also took her dog.

Rod Stewart, Cyndi Lauper Ready To Rock Tampa

Rod Stewart and Cyndi Lauper are joining forces for an 18-show tour later this year that includes a July stop at Tampa’s Amalie Arena. Tickets for the July 8 show go on sale Jan. 27.

Eagle Family Weathers Florida’s Storms

As residents across West Central Florida hunkered down for a night of severe weather Sunday, it appears that eagles Harriet and M15 did the same. The famous eagle couple and their recently hatched eaglet, E9, weathered the storms quite well.
